Question 1: Write about evolution of an art of Software engineering discipline.
Question 2: Describe the unified approach to software development. Describe the merits and demerits of this approach.
Question 3:
a) Describe the five software assessment principles.
b) Describe about different phases of assessment.
Question 4:
a) Why requirements review is conducted? Describe various types of it.
b) What is requirements management? Why is it required?
Question 5: By using your own knowledge of how an ATM is used, develop a set of use-cases that could be used to derive the needs for an ATM system.
Question 6:
a) What is meant by the term User Interface? What are the three areas which user interface design focuses? Describe them.
b) Describe the significance of user interface design?